选择合适的代码编辑器是每位初学者在学习编程时必须面对的重要决策。市场上有许多不同的代码编辑器,各具特色,适合不同需求和水平的人群。这篇文章将帮助你理解如何找到最适合自己的代码编辑器,并分享一些使用技巧和建议。

不同的编程语言需要不同特性的编辑器。例如,Python开发者可能更喜欢简单易用的编辑器,而Web开发者则可能需要支持HTML、CSS和JavaScript等多种语言的编辑器。一些编辑器如Visual Studio Code(VS Code)和Sublime Text也因其丰富的插件生态系统和强大的社区支持而受到欢迎。这些因素往往成为初学者选择编辑器时的重要考虑。
另一个关键的因素是性能。即使是初学者,使用效率高的编辑器能够显著提升学习和开发的体验。通常,内存占用和加载速度是评价编辑器性能的重要指标。一些轻量级的编辑器能够快速响应,适合各种硬件配置,而一些功能丰富的编辑器可能需要更高的系统要求。
为了帮助初学者选择合适的工具,以下几点建议值得参考:
1. 界面友好性:确保编辑器的用户界面清晰简洁,容易上手的设计可以让你更快地集中精力在代码上。比如,Atom和VS Code的界面就非常直观,对于初学者来说使用起来非常方便。
2. 插件与扩展:选择一款能够支持插件的编辑器,可以在学习的过程中逐步扩展其功能。VS Code和JetBrains系列都提供了丰富的扩展包,能够满足不同开发需求。
3. 社区支持:一个活跃的用户社区可以提供大量的学习资源,包括教程、代码示例和解决方案。选择社区活跃的编辑器,有助于你在学习过程中获得他人的经验和帮助。
4. 跨平台能力:如果你在不同平台(如Windows、MacOS和Linux)上使用电脑,那么选择一个支持跨平台的编辑器是明智的。这样可以保持工作环境的一致性,避免出现不同平台间的适应问题。
5. 自定义功能:每位开发者的工作习惯不同,选择一款可供自定义的编辑器可以更好地适应个人需求。通过设置快捷键和主题等,可以提高工作效率,减轻学习负担。
对于初学者而言,试用几款不同的代码编辑器也是一个不错的选择。许多编辑器提供免费版或试用版,可以让你在决定前进行充分的体验。通过实际使用,找到最适合自己的工具,将大大提升学习的效率和乐趣。
常见问题解答:
1. 什么是代码编辑器?
代码编辑器是一种用于编写和编辑源代码的工具,通常具备语法高亮、代码补全等功能。
2. 初学者应该选择哪个代码编辑器?
初学者可以选择Visual Studio Code、Sublime Text或Atom,这些编辑器易于使用且功能强大。
3. 如何提高代码编辑器的使用效率?
利用插件扩展功能、设置常用快捷键和自定义界面等方式可以显著提高使用效率。
4. 代码编辑器的性能重要吗?
是的,速度和响应能力直接影响开发体验,选择性能较好的编辑器可以减少卡顿感。
5. 如何选择支持跨平台的编辑器?
确认所选编辑器官网说明,查看是否支持多种操作系统。大多数现代编辑器都具备此功能。
